Output 3d95e260a5609e3173a05ac1a1f5f0fa3d683fa6f0eac93854f85f395dc56d21:2

value
95292136
script pubkey
OP_0 OP_PUSHBYTES_20 2a1e2eb044bcf8326ba47a70cbd9b7a120d1e07f
address
bc1q9g0zavzyhnury6ay0fcvhkdh5ysdrcrl2nd960
transaction
3d95e260a5609e3173a05ac1a1f5f0fa3d683fa6f0eac93854f85f395dc56d21
spent
true